Output 3b8c0c56934b51be1771c9a6ab2083145c608a795c7ee0299cd62c6629a810d9:1

value
18392778
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1690aa028dd48d34007d8f14194b725043e2498e OP_EQUALVERIFY OP_CHECKSIG
address
134KAfBN4VNEWJeK1K45KJ6WupyqCtv7oa
transaction
3b8c0c56934b51be1771c9a6ab2083145c608a795c7ee0299cd62c6629a810d9
spent
true